coolant temp problem
lately ive been having a problem with my coolant temp. after i warm the car up to operating temp the gauge only reads to not even the half way point so it says its reading somewhat cool. although i know that it has to be wrong considering my setup is a gsr boosted at 10 psi. even when i hit full boost the gauge still doesnt even hit the halfway mark. i recently just changed the thermostat and it didnt fix the problem. i was thinking maybe the coolant temp sensor but not sure. anyone with any ideas? it would be greatly appreciated.

your thermostat could be stuck open maybe..
my gauge would barely move so i checked the thermostat and it was stuck open
.
changed it and now it warms up right away
